Overview

International data expert to provide technical assistance to selected country Parties with UNCCD reporting in English and Spanish, supporting timely, complete, and high-quality report submissions.

Tasks Summary
  • Provide technical support for the planning, organization, and delivery of capacity-building workshops.
  • Conduct a full practice run of calculating UNCCD indicators using Trends.Earth and uploading results in PRAIS.
  • Assist countries in understanding UNCCD reporting requirements, indicators, and default data.
  • Develop Spanish-language technical notes on dataset specifications and differences.
  • Test the suitability of high-resolution global land cover and productivity datasets.
  • Guide countries in using PRAIS 4, including data entry, map tools, file uploads, messaging, and other system features.
  • Manage topic-specific PRAIS chat rooms in Spanish.
  • Support the progression of national reports in PRAIS 4, including expert review.
  • Host demand-driven technical webinars in English and Spanish.
  • Respond to country queries through the UNCCD online helpdesk within 48 hours.
  • Monitor reporting progress in assigned countries and maintain regular liaison with Parties.
  • Maintain ongoing contact with assigned Parties via PRAIS communication tools and other channels.
  • Participate in online technical sessions with tool developers and data producers.
  • Attend regular coordination meetings organized by the secretariat.
  • Assist with reviewing translations of e-learning materials and disseminating capacity-building resources.
  • Contribute to a final Technical Backstopping report.
Experience Requirements
  • Minimum 5 years working experience in Geographical Information systems (GIS) and remote sensing applications.
  • Demonstrated experience in providing capacity-building support to countries, particularly in the context of environmental monitoring, data management, or international reporting frameworks.
  • Experience in processing, managing and analysing geospatial data in the land domain, including spatial and multi-temporal analysis of land cover, land productivity, soil organic carbon stocks and/or drought.
  • Experience with human population data would be an added advantage.
  • Good knowledge of the Latin America and the Caribbean region.
  • Experience in geodata processing software (e.g. QGIS).
  • Familiarity with Trends.Earth.
  • Experience in dealing with numerical data in different formats, importing/exporting, translating formats etc.
  • Familiarity with a programming language such as Python.
  • Experience in or familiarity with the UNCCD reporting modalities would be advantageous.
Qualification Requirements

• Advanced university degree (Master’s degree or equivalent) in data science, environmental science, natural resource management or a related field is required. A first-level university degree in combination with qualifying experience may be accepted in lieu of the advanced university degree.
